No traffic road cycling routes around Monsteroux-Milieu traverse a rural landscape within France's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region, characterized by varied terrain. The area features lush forests, tranquil bodies of water, and open plains offering scenic views over the Bièvre-Valloire plain. Road cyclists can expect a mix of gentle gradients and more challenging ascents, with elevations reaching over 1,200 meters. The region's geography provides diverse backdrops for cycling, from agricultural fields to wooded areas.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ic road cycling routes are available around Monsteroux-Milieu?

There are over 35 dedicated no-traffic road cycling routes in the Monsteroux-Milieu area, catering to various skill levels. You'll find a good mix of moderate and challenging options, with a few easier routes as well.

What kind of terrain can I expect on no-traffic road cycling routes in Monsteroux-Milieu?

The routes around Monsteroux-Milieu offer varied terrain, from the expansive views of the Bièvre-Valloire plain to more undulating sections through lush forests and past tranquil bodies of water. You'll experience the rural charm of the Isère department, with scenic countryside views throughout your ride.

Are there any long-distance no-traffic road cycling routes for experienced riders?

Yes, for experienced riders looking for a challenge, routes like the Montjoux Pond – A travers champs loop from Montseveroux offer over 100 km of cycling with significant elevation gain. Another excellent option is the Route de Beausoleil – A travers champs loop from Eyzin-Pinet, which also covers over 100 km through diverse landscapes.

What historical or cultural sites can I see along the no-traffic road cycling routes?

Many routes pass by interesting historical and cultural sites. For instance, the area features the historic Revel washhouse in the former medieval village of Revel, and the serene La Salette Chapel with its admirable views. You might also encounter the impressive Saint-Pierre Church of Assieu, built in 1540, on some of the local loops.

Are there any moderate-difficulty no-traffic road cycling routes suitable for a half-day ride?

Absolutely. A moderate route like the Saint-Pierre Church of Assieu – Bois Marquis Garden loop from Vernioz is around 52 km and can be completed in a half-day. It offers a blend of natural landscapes and historical sites without being overly strenuous.

What do other cyclists say about the no-traffic road cycling routes in Monsteroux-Milieu?

The no-traffic road cycling routes in Monsteroux-Milieu are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ars from over 25 reviews. Cyclists frequently praise the peaceful rural environment, the varied terrain, and the beautiful views over the Bièvre-Valloire plain.

Can I find shorter, easier no-traffic road cycling loops near Monsteroux-Milieu?

Yes, if you're looking for a shorter, more accessible ride, there are options available. The Roadbike loop from Monsteroux-Milieu is a moderate 23 km route that starts directly from the commune, offering a pleasant ride without heavy traffic.

Are there any specific viewpoints or scenic spots along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Many routes offer stunning views, particularly over the Bièvre-Valloire plain. The region is characterized by its rural scenery, lush forests, and tranquil bodies of water, providing numerous picturesque spots. Keep an eye out for elevated sections that offer panoramic vistas of the surrounding countryside.

What is the best season for no-traffic road cycling in Monsteroux-Milieu?

The region is generally pleasant for cycling from spring through autumn. Spring brings blooming landscapes, while autumn offers beautiful foliage. Summer is also suitable, with routes often passing through shaded forests providing relief from the sun. Always check local weather conditions before heading out.

Are there any challenging no-traffic road cycling routes with significant elevation?

For those seeking a challenge, routes like the Plateau des Grises – Barbe Bleue Pass - 352 m loop from Montseveroux provide nearly 1000 meters of elevation gain over 79 km, testing your climbing abilities while offering rewarding views of the region.

Are there any facilities like cafes or restaurants along the no-traffic road cycling routes?

While Monsteroux-Milieu itself is a rural commune, many routes pass through or near small villages where you might find local cafes or restaurants. It's always a good idea to plan your stops in advance, especially on longer rides, and carry sufficient water and snacks.
